Abstract

Attempts were made to established one-step multiplex PCR assay for the fraud identification of the mostly used species in deer products (bovine, ovine, porcine and poultry). Primers were selected from published papers or designed in the well-conserved region of tRNA-Val and 16S rRNA mitochondrial genes after alignment of the available sequences in the GenBank database. The primers generated specific fragments of 124, 183, 225 and 290 bp length for bovine, poultry, ovine and porcine, respectively. The detection limit was 1 ng for porcine and ovine primers, 5 ng for poultry primers and 0.5 ng for bovine primers. The results demonstrated that fraud phenomena are very epidemic in the deer products, especially heart, blood, penis and antler products. The multiplex PCR described in this study, proved to be very sensitive and reliable in species identification, could be considered as a further improvement of traditional methods based assay for the identification of deer products.
